The Yuzuki Avaota-A1 is an ARM64 based Single Board Computer powered by Allwinner A527 Octa-Core ARM Cortex-A55 64-Bit CPU @2.0GHz, ARM Mali G56 GPU and RISC-V XuanTie E906 CPU@200MHz. It provides onboard eMMC, MicroSD Card slot, PCI-e, Pi-2 Bus, USB 3.0, and many other peripheral interfaces for makers to integrate with sensors and other devices.

SoC and Memory Specification
- Based on Allwinner A527
CPU Architecture
- Quad-core ARM Cortex-A55 at 2.0 GHz
- AArch32 for full backwards compatibility with ARMv7
- ARM Neon Advanced SIMD (single instruction, multiple data) support for accelerated media and signal processing computation
- Includes VFP hardware to support single and double-precision operations
- ARMv8 Cryptography Extensions
- Integrated 32KB L1 instruction cache and 32KB L1 data cache per core
- Integrated 64KB L2 instruction cache and 128KB L2 data cache per cluster
- 1MB unified system L3 cache
GPU Architecture
- Mali-G57 Valhall GPU@850MHz
- 4x Multi-Sampling Anti-Aliasing (MSAA) with minimal performance drop
- 128KB L2 Cache configurations
- Supports OpenGL ES 1.1, 2.0, and 3.2
- Supports Vulkan 1.1
- Supports OpenCL 1.1, 1.2, 2.0 Full Profile
- Supports Renderscript
- L2 Cache Configurable 64KB – 512KB
- 64KB-128KB for 1-Core
- 128KB-256KB for 2-Core
- 256KB for 3-Core
- 1x256KB-2x256KB for 4-Core
- 2x256KB-2x512KB for 5-Core and 6-Core configurations
- Supports 3400 Mpix/s fill rate when at 850MHz clock frequency
- Supports 243.2 GLOP/s when at 850MHz clock frequency for peak single precision (FP32) performance
System Memory
- LPDDR4 RAM Memory Variants: 2GB and 4GB.
Board Features
Video
- Digital Video output up to 4K@60Hz
- H.264/AVC Base/Main/High/High10 profile @ level 5.1; up to 4K×2K @ 30fps
- H.265/HEVC Main/Main10 profile @ level 5.1 High-tier; up to 4K×2K @ 60fps
Audio
- 3.5mm audio Jack
Network
- Dual 10/100/1000Mbps Ethernet
- 2.4GHz/5Ghz MIMO WiFi 802.11 b/g/n/ac with Bluetooth 5.2
Storage
- on-board 128Mbit (16MByte) XSPI NOR flash memory - bootable
- microSD - bootable, supports SDHC and SDXC and storage up to 256GB
- eMMC - bootable on-board 16GB or 32GB
Expansion Ports
- 2×20 pins "Pi2" GPIO Header
- 4 lane MiPi DSI port for LCD panel
- 4 lane MiPi CSI port for camera module
- 1× USB3.0 OTG port
- 1× USB2.0 Host port
- 1× USB2.0 OTG port
- 1× CAN port
Board Information, Schematics and Certifications
Input Power: DC 12V @ 3A 5.5mmOD/2.1mmID center-positive Barrel DC Jack connector

Certifications:
- Disclaimer: Please note that PINE64 SBC is not a "final" product and in general certification is not necessary. However, PINE64 still submits the SBC for FCC, CE, and ROHS certifications and obtain the certificates to prove that the SBC board can pass the testing. Please note, a final commercial product needs to perform its own testing and obtain its own certificate.
